The YSBLC12C is a bidirectional TVS (Transient Voltage Suppressor) diode array designed by Yea Shin Technology. It is specifically designed to protect sensitive electronic components from ESD (Electrostatic Discharge), EFT (Electrical Fast Transients), and surge events. The YSBLC12C offers a low clamping voltage and fast response time, making it an ideal solution for safeguarding data and power lines in various applications.
Applications:
- USB ports
- HDMI interfaces
- Ethernet ports
- Data lines
- Power lines
Features:
- Bidirectional protection: Protects against both positive and negative transient voltages.
- Low clamping voltage: Limits the voltage across the protected components during a transient event.
- Fast response time: Quickly clamps transient voltages to safe levels.
- Small surface-mount package: Suitable for high-density PCB layouts.
- RoHS compliant: Environmentally friendly, lead-free construction.

The YSBLC12C is commonly used in consumer electronics, telecommunications equipment, and industrial automation systems. It provides a reliable and cost-effective solution for protecting sensitive electronic circuits from the damaging effects of transient voltage events. The bidirectional protection feature makes it particularly well-suited for applications where both positive and negative transients are possible.
Technical Specifications:
- Reverse Working Voltage: Typically 12V
- Clamping Voltage: Specified at a given transient current
- Peak Pulse Power: Depends on the waveform and duration
- Operating Temperature Range: Typically -55°C to +125°C
